The queen, by Mr Paramouer, v. Thomas Pounde and John Sherleye. Marshes belonging to the manor of Downebarton. Whether Warde Marsh and Waterdale Marsh are distinct marshes, and are in Warde Marsh Valley or Brokesende Valley? Whether Brokesende Valley is taxed by the commissioners of sewers of Warde Marsh Valley? Scot paid by the whole of Warde Marsh Valley, except Upland marsh, Waterdale marsh, Waterdale meadow, and Molhill marsh, for repairing the sea wall. Cost of laying sluices to carry their water from Brokesend Valleye along, by, and through Warde marshe, borne by the occupiers of Brokesende Valley. Kent.
